The Mechanism of Connection#

The foundational element of the hive mind in Pluribus is the "Joining". This process is not merely a metaphorical link but a tangible, physical connection facilitated by technology. The primary medium for this connection is radio waves, a form of electromagnetic radiation.

Radio waves are a well-established part of the electromagnetic spectrum, commonly used for communication. In the context of Pluribus, this technology is repurposed to create a direct link between biological minds. The implication is that specialized devices or biological modifications allow the brain's neural signals to be transmitted and received via these waves.

This method of connection suggests a two-way data stream. Information flows from each individual to the collective and vice versa, creating a continuous loop of shared thought and sensory input. The physics at play involve the modulation of radio frequencies to encode and decode complex neural patterns, a concept that, while speculative, is rooted in real-world principles of neurotechnology and wireless communication.

The Science Behind the Fiction#

While the "Joining" is a fictional construct, its basis in radio wave physics gives it a veneer of plausibility. Real-world science already explores the interface between technology and the brain through Brain-Computer Interfaces (BCIs). Current BCIs can interpret neural signals to control external devices, but they do not yet enable the kind of direct, wireless mind-to-mind communication seen in Pluribus.

The leap from today's technology to the "Joining" involves significant advancements in several fields:

  • Neural Decoding: Accurately translating brain activity into digital data.
  • Wireless Data Transfer: Transmitting vast amounts of neural data in real-time.
  • Signal Integration: Safely inputting received data into another brain's neural pathways.

The series uses the concept of radio waves as a narrative device to explore these possibilities. It serves as a bridge between the known science of electromagnetism and the speculative future of human consciousness, making the hive mind concept both intriguing and thought-provoking.
